PRAYER in both petitions: Civil Revision Petition is filed under Article 227 of the Constitution of India, seeking a direction to the Principal District Munsif Court, Kuzhithurai to dispose E.P.No.18 of 2020 in O.S.No.429 of 2010 within a stipulated period that may be fixed by this Court.
For Petitioner : Mr.S.Sivakumar
O R D E R
This Civil Revision Petition has been filed seeking a direction to the learned Principal District Munsif, Kuzhithurai to dispose E.P.No.18 of 2020 in O.S.No.429 of 2010 within a stipulated period that may be fixed by this Court.
1/3
2. A report was called for from the Execution Court on 06.03.2024. The Principal District Musnif, Kuzhithurai, has sent a report dated 12.03.2024. In that report, it is stated that the case is posted on 23.03.2024 for clarification.
3. In view of the long pendency of the matter, there shall be a direction to the learned Principal District Munsif, Kuzhithurai to dispose of E.P.No.18 of 2020 in O.S.No.429 of 2010 within a period of three(3) months from date of receipt of a copy of this order.
4. With the above direction, this Civil Revision Petition is disposed of. No costs.
